Cheers! ———————–PRESS RELEASE———————– VonSeitz TheoreticAles releases “Le Noir” VonSeitz TheoreticAles has released “Le Noir” a Belgian Style “Southern” Pale Ale. “Le Noir” is our homage to “Le Noir” A Belgian southern Bistro located in downtown Lenoir City, TN. The restaurant, owned by Chef Jan Van Geyt, blends traditional Belgian and European cuisine with a southern flair. Guests can find traditional Belgian dishes along with dishes that are more familiar in the South. Le Noir offers a selection of Belgian and European beer and wine, as well as some traditional offerings that are familiar in the states. “Le Noir” a Belgian Style “Southern” Pale ale is our take on the style.
